We are seeking a highly motivated, analytical, and retail‐centric CRM Intern to support our Regional Clienteling team. In this role, you will bridge the gap between corporate strategy and retail execution, serving as a vital support system for our Stores while gaining a confident mastery of regional strategy. You will assist in tracking client data, monitoring campaign performance, and analyzing segment behaviours to drive client retention, recruitment, and engagement.

This position offers a unique, hands‐on opportunity to work closely with Store teams and cross‐functional corporate leaders to optimize our client funnel, deliver tailored store assets, evaluate event performances, and support regional strategy execution.

Job Responsibilities
  • Advanced Reporting & Systems Management
    • Utilize and maintain Power BI, Salesforce, and advanced Excel tools to extract, clean, and visualize complex CRM data.
    • Compile and distribute weekly/monthly dashboards that provide a macro view of regional trends down to micro‐store metrics.
    • Monitor and report on Store and CA performance across key funnel metrics, specifically Local Sales, Appointments, and Outreaches.
    • Actively monitor corporate client lists to identify fresh opportunities for client engagement and track long‐term segment evolution.
  • Segment Evolution & Penetration Analytics
    • Monitor and report on KPIs across distinct client segments, including client volume, total sales, retention rates, purchase frequency, and average spend.
    • Evaluate the effectiveness of targeted client touchpoints and boutique activation channels (Outreaches, completed Appointments, Events, and Gifting campaigns).
  • Boutique Support & Tailored Clienteling Strategies
    • Extract, clean, and segment high‐potential client lists tailored to specific store needs, product launches, or regional animations.
    • Analyze dormant or unassigned client databases to facilitate seamless client reassignments to active Client Advisors (CAs), ensuring no relationship opportunity is lost.
    • Partner with Store Managers and CAs to provide data‐driven insights, helping them understand their local client base and build bespoke outreach strategies.
    • Act as a reliable point of contact for stores regarding CRM tool troubleshooting, list requests, and clienteling best practices.
  • Team Performance & Capability Mapping
    • Consolidate data to review how various sales and client‐facing teams are performing against core CRM KPIs.
    • Assist in mapping out team capabilities, regional coverage, and performance metrics to help optimize client allocation and store support.
Profile & Qualifications
  • Education: Ideally currently pursuing or recently completed a degree in Business Administration, Marketing, Luxury Brand Management, Data Analytics, or a related field.
  • Technical & Analytical Skills:
    • Proficiency or strong foundational knowledge in Power BI and Salesforce.
    • Advanced Excel skills (VLOOKUPs, Pivot Tables, data manipulation).
    • Strong analytical agility—the ability to zoom out to identify macro regional trends while maintaining absolute precision on micro‐store/CA metrics.
  • Retail & Service Orientation: A strong desire to empower retail teams. You understand that data is most valuable when it directly helps Client Advisors succeed on the sales floor.
  • Detail‐Oriented: High level of precision when managing corporate client lists, event mappings, and performance reports.
  • Communication Skills: Excellent written and verbal communication skills to collaborate effectively with both corporate stakeholders and boutique teams.
  • Passion for Luxury: A strong understanding of, or keen interest in, the luxury retail landscape and VIP clienteling behaviours.
